WebIn short — no. A bank is normally a lender. That means they lend you the money. Remember, a mortgage is essentially a very big, very long loan. If you use a mortgage broker, they’re not the ones actually loaning you the money for your home — instead, they look at the loans offered by many different lenders, including banks, to find the ...
